The Haegemonia series can be quite complicated in terms of getting your economy to run well. The combat is a bit lack luster, and it is necessary for the majority of the game, but I've always found setting up my planets the most fun to come out of that game.

There's also Aurora, yes combat will be a major part of it, mostly for defence purposes, but the number of options given to you by the economy is fantastic. There exists almost two kinds of economies IIRC, one is a functional military one, and the other civilian which isn't in your control. Along with the same idea as Aurora, there's Distant Worlds that also has an independant civilian, or largely automated economy. You can influence what your empire does and can use direct control, but due to the huge size of your empire it's quite likely that the former is what you'll be doing most of the time.
